Fluid inclusions in cavity quartz crystals in rapakivi from Luumäki, southeastern Finland [PDF]
Fluid inclusions in selected cavity quartz crystals in rapakivi granite from Luumäki, southeastern Finland, were studied by microthermometric methods.

Stibnite was mined until the end of the twentieth century in the Schlaining ore district, Austria, near the easternmost border of the Eastern Alps where windows of Penninic ophiolites and metasediments are exposed below Austroalpine tectonic units.

Fluid Inclusion and Sulfur Isotope Study on the Donggualin Gold Deposit in the Ailaoshan Gold Belt
Fluid inclusions and sulfur isotopes can reveal the characteristics of ore-forming fluid and the origin of ore-forming materials, which are important indicators for ore genesis.
